Output 38828177b2e18f41725cda658c95bbb2bc874d98816e2a7007e2368873586d1b:0

value
104705882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a7c229a785490fc5b87611109000dde0a1a45d OP_EQUAL
address
MChaLU2C5mKqE7UnAjNkG6pb2nB7mmdVn3
transaction
38828177b2e18f41725cda658c95bbb2bc874d98816e2a7007e2368873586d1b
spent
true